We developed a novel non-transgenic mouse model of vas- cular cognitive impairment (VCI), by feeding chronic cerebral hypoperfusion mice with diet deficient in folate, B6, and B12 and supplemented with excess methionine. Resting-state functional connectivity (rs-fc) map, is commonly used to assess brain function. In this study, we used the Laser Speckle Contrast Imaging (LSCI) to map rs-fc based on cerebral blood flow (CBF) dynamics. Tem- poral synchrony between regional cerebral blood flow (CBF) were analyzed for both the control and VCI model group mice.
